Job Description:
POSITION: Turtle Mountain Community Schools Summer Baseball Coach
TERM OF EMPLOYMENT: June 25th – July 23rd Maximum of 250 hours; Subject to change
LOCATION: Turtle Mountain Community High School
QUALIFICATIONS: Applicants must meet qualifications for the position
Applicants must attach/submit all documentation to be considered for a position.
Education: Must have High School Diploma or GED.
Must have a valid Driver’s License.
Must have coaching experience in baseball or softball.
Must be able to work flexible hours, possibly weekends.
Personal Attributes: Punctuality, reliability, positive human relations skills, personal conduct appropriate to a positive role model for student in areas of lawfulness, behavior, moral character, and skilled in student training.
Successful applicants must have a favorable background check according to district policy.
Position Sensitivity Level: Low Risk

PERFORMANCE RESPONSIBILITIES:
The Summer Baseball Coach(s) will coach students involved in the Summer Baseball Program.
Responsible to Athletic/Activities Director.
Responsible for scheduling games and transportation along with Atheltic/Activities Director
Responsible for transporting students to activity sites.
May be required to take defensive driving course.
Responsible for setting up practice schedules.
Responsible for supervision of children at practice and games.
Assist with setting up summer Babe Ruth Baseball schedule for students participating in the summer programs.
Maintain participant discipline at all times.
Responsible for equipment maintence and up keep.
Perform other duties as assigned by the Athletic/Activities Director.
The Program will run based on number of participants.
This vacancy announcement reflects management’s assignment of essential functions; it does not prescribe or restrict tasks that may be assigned.
RANGE OF SALARY: $15/hour
